FPL (short for FACEIT Pro League) is an in-house practice/competition environment organized by FACEIT, exclusively for players at the highest level. With pro players currently competing for top teams and a prize pool of up to $20,000 each month, FPL is a true playground with extremely high-quality competition, where pro players have the opportunity to practice and meet outstanding young talents. This is also where many young talents are discovered and have the opportunity to rise to professionalism, such as ZywOo (Vitality), oBo (Complexity), frozen, or Ropz (Mousesports),…

Yesterday, the FPL qualifiers for March concluded and among the list of new players, one notable name is m0NESY, the prodigy currently playing for Na`Vi Junior. Although he did not qualify (finishing 6th in the qualifiers), his devastating performance truly impressed the organizers, leading them to invite him to compete. At just 14 years old, he is one of the youngest players in FPL history. In this list, we can see a series of young stars currently competing professionally, like oBo (who joined FPL at 15), ropz (competing in FPL since 17), or frozen (the youngest player in FPL history at 13)…

m0NESY started playing CS 1.6 at the age of 6 and switched to CS:GO at 9, taking only one year to reach GE rank; by 12, he had reached level 10 on FACEIT (after just 150 games) and now has nearly 9,000 hours of CS:GO playtime. Before transitioning to CS:GO, m0NESY had 3,000 hours of Dota 2 gameplay, but he later abandoned it to pursue professional CS:GO after being introduced to it by his older brother. m0NESY joined Na`Vi Junior in January 2020 and has delivered impressive performances, securing victories for the team.
Not only m0NESY, but another player currently competing for Na`Vi Junior, Aunkere, also passed the qualifiers, finishing 3rd overall. FPL is truly becoming a fantastic training ground for young talents to hone their skills and showcase their abilities before they turn 16 to join professional teams.
